iOS Succinctly – Syncfusion’s Free Ebook Reviewed

iOS succinctly free ebook syncfusioniOS Succinctly by Syncfusion is one of the most concise books on iOS I have read. It is the second book in a two-part series on iPhone and iPad app development. Objective-C Succinctly was the initial book and it covered Objective-C and core data structures used by virtually all iOS applications.

iOS Succinctly obviously assumes that you know Objective-C and am basically familiar with the Xcode integrated development environment (IDE). Both of these books are written by Ryan Hodson, so they obviously compliment each other perfectly.

iOS was designed with security in mind. Unlike other mobile operating systems (cough*Android*cough) iOS will not give your application access to the Apple device’s entire file system. iOS gives every application its own separate file system. This is also called sandboxing. What this means is that your application will not have access to files used and generated by other applications. (more…)
